第一步:字体从电脑导出
Window+R输入cmd回车
输入fc-list -f "%{family}\n" :lang=zh >d:zhfont.txt 回车(enter键)
可以用tex编辑器打开zhfont.txt(d盘),比如texstudio;也可以用Notepad++。若用记事本打开,则可能出现乱码。
第二步:设置中文字体
\documentclass!{article}
\usepackage[paperwidth=6cm,paperheight=8cm]{geometry}
\usepackage{xeCJK}
\newcommand{\shusong}{\CJKfontspec{FZShuSong-Z01S}}%方正书宋
\newcommand{\heiti}{\CJKfontspec{FZHei-B01S}}%方正黑体
\newcommand{\kaishu}{\CJKfontspec{FZKai-Z03S}}%方正楷体
\newcommand{\xingkai}{\CJKfontspec{STXingkai}}%华文行楷
\begin{document}
\noindent
\xingkai 这是华文行楷\\
\heiti 这是方正黑体\\
\kaishu 这是方正楷体\\
\shusong 这是方正书宋
\end{document}
第三步:字体刷新。
若有新安装的字体则需要刷新,否则卡。
法I. 清空\texlive\2018\texmf-var\fonts\cache\中的文件
法II. 命令提示符(管理员)fc-cache -fsv。一般3次就可以了
法III. 管理员身份运行fc-cache。一般3次就可以了
附录1:ctex宏包里定义的字体命令
\documentclass{ctexart}
\begin{document}
\begin{tabular}{|lll|}
\hline
\songti 宋体 & SimSun &\verb|\songti 宋体| \\
\kaishu 楷体 & KaiTi &\verb|\kaishu 楷体| \\
\heiti 黑体 & SimHei &\verb|\heiti 黑体| \\
\yahei 微软雅黑 & Microsoft YaHei &\verb|\yahei 微软雅黑| \\
\fangsong 仿宋 & FangSong &\verb|\fangsong 仿宋| \\
\youyuan 幼圆 & YouYuan &\verb|\youyuan 幼圆| \\
\lishu 隶书 & LiSu &\verb|\lishu 隶书| \\
\hline
\end{tabular}
\end{document}
附录2:华文系列字体自定义命令
\documentclass{ctexart}
\usepackage{xeCJK}
\renewcommand{\songti}{\CJKfontspec{STSong}}% 华文宋体
\newcommand{\zhongsong}{\CJKfontspec{STZhongsong}}%华文中宋
\renewcommand{\kaishu}{\CJKfontspec{STKaiti}}%华文楷体
\newcommand{\xingkai}{\CJKfontspec{STXingkai}}%华文行楷
\newcommand{\xihei}{\CJKfontspec{STXihei}}%华文细黑
\renewcommand{\fangsong}{\CJKfontspec{STFangsong}}%华文仿宋
\renewcommand{\lishu}{\CJKfontspec{STLiti}}%华文隶书
\newcommand{\caiyun}{\CJKfontspec{STCaiyun}}%华文彩云
\newcommand{\hupo}{\CJKfontspec{STHupo}}%华文琥珀
\begin{document}
\begin{tabular}{|cll|}
\hline
\songti 华文宋体 & STSong & \verb|\songti 华文宋体| \\
\zhongsong 华文中宋 & STZhongsong & \verb|\zhongsong 华文中宋| \\
\kaishu 华文楷体 & STKaiti & \verb|\kaishu 华文楷体| \\
\xingkai 华文行楷 & STXingkai & \verb|\xingkai 华文行楷| \\
\xihei 华文细黑 & STXihei & \verb|\xihei 华文细黑| \\
\fangsong 华文仿宋 & STFangsong & \verb|\fangsong 华文仿宋| \\
\lishu 华文隶书 & STLiti & \verb|\lishu 华文隶书| \\
\caiyun 华文彩云 & STCaiyun & \verb|\caiyun 华文彩云| \\
\hupo 华文琥珀 & STHupo & \verb|\hupo 华文琥珀| \\
\hline
\end{tabular}
\end{document}
附录3:adobe系列字体自定义命令
\documentclass{ctexart}
\usepackage{xeCJK}
\renewcommand{\songti}{\CJKfontspec{Adobe Song Std L}}% adobe 宋体
\renewcommand{\kaishu}{\CJKfontspec{Adobe Kaiti Std R}}% adobe 楷体
\renewcommand{\heiti}{\CJKfontspec{Adobe Heiti Std R}}% adobe 黑体
\renewcommand{\fangsong}{\CJKfontspec{Adobe Fangsong Std R}}% adobe 仿宋
\begin{document}
\begin{tabular}{|cll|}
\hline
\songti adobe宋体 & Adobe Song Std L & \verb|\songti adobe宋体| \\
\kaishu adobe楷体 & Adobe Kaiti Std R & \verb|\kaishu adobe楷体| \\
\heiti adobe黑体 & Adobe Heiti Std R & \verb|\heiti adobe黑体| \\
\fangsong adobe仿宋 & Adobe Fangsong Std R & \verb|\fangsong adobe仿宋| \\
\hline
\end{tabular}
\end{document}
附录4 思源字体
% 西文字体
\setmainfont{Source Serif Pro}
\setsansfont{Source Sans Pro}
\setmonofont{Source Code Pro}
% 中文字体
\setCJKmainfont{Source Han Serif SC} % 思源宋体 V1
\setCJKsansfont{Source Han Sans SC} % 思源黑体 V2
\setCJKmonofont{Source Han Sans SC}
\renewcommand{\songti}{\CJKfontspec{Source Han Serif SC}} % 思源宋体 V1
\renewcommand{\heiti}{\CJKfontspec{Source Han Sans SC}} % 思源黑体 V2
\newcommand{\cusong}{\CJKfontspec{Source Han Serif SC Bold}}
% 思源字体 V1
%\renewcommand{\songti}{\CJKfontspec{Noto Serif CJK SC}} % 思源宋体 V1
%\renewcommand{\heiti}{\CJKfontspec{Noto Sans CJK SC}} % 思源黑体 V1
%\newcommand{\cusong}{\CJKfontspec{Noto Serif CJK SC Bold}}
安装思源字体:右键字体文件选择为所有人安装